So, I was wondering how should I open an online store (obviously in the pretense of making money), and the first issue I came across was, well... what do I sell? I had a friend who sells some shit online, and I know he sells Rubik's cubes. From the talk of his experiences, he was doing quite well. From that, I realized three problems: "I need to sell something quite storage-able" (like something small), "I would like to at least have a passion for what I'm selling" (mine friend loved Rubik's cubes btw), and finally "It had to actually be sell-able". I was willing to buy my merchandise in bulk, but it actually needs to be sold. I don't want to lose money so this was my biggest issue. Then I discovered dropshipping. It sounds to good to be true. You get a guaranteed buyer then you buy the merchandise, and you get money, even though you didn't buy in bulk. I LOVE IT. No one buys it, you don't lose anything.

So I want to know your opinions, compared to the traditional retailer selling methods, or whatever you call it, what's the downsides to dropshipping?
 
Major downside imo is shipping time. It can take up to 60 days to receive the product if you're dropshipping from China (most likely). It'll piss off some customers which means less repeat buyers, so you'll need to be on top of customer support.

Depends on how you dropship. People most of the time think of AliExpress when they hear dropship.

Dropshipping locally from local distributors would be best in sense of quality and delivery time and has less headaches but will cost more and a smaller market.
